Down House
Photo: Anthonyeatworld,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Down House is the former home of the English naturalist Charles Darwin and his family. It was in this house and garden that Darwin worked on his theory of evolution by natural selection, which he had conceived in London before moving to Down. Down House is situated 360 feet northeast of Laboratory.

St Mary’s Church, Downe
Church
Photo: Philip Talmage, CC BY-SA 2.0.
St Mary's Church in the village of Downe, Bromley is the Church of England Parish Church for the parish of Downe. It is a Grade II* listed building, which dates from the 13th century. St Mary’s Church, Downe is situated 1,900 feet north of Laboratory.

Downe
Village
Photo: Lunarsnowflakes, Public domain.
Downe, formerly Down, is a village in Greater London, England, located within the London Borough of Bromley, which formed part of the historical county of Kent until 1965, and is beyond London's urban sprawl.

Biggin Hill
Town
Photo: Philip Talmage,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Biggin Hill is a town in the London Borough of Bromley, about 15.2 miles south-southeast of Charing Cross. It is separated from London's built-up area by the Metropolitan green belt and is located adjacent to the Greater London boundary with Kent and Surrey.
